Package: apt-build Severity: serious Tags: patch apt-build segfaults when using make_options This appears to be due to a typo in config.c (line 141) if(args.make_options && strlen(args.options) && (str = strtok(args.options, " "))) {
The code appears to check the validity of the wrong pointer, and should be... if(args.options && strlen(args.options) && (str = strtok(args.options, " "))) { This fixes the seg-fault problem -- System Information: Debian Release: 3.1 APT prefers testing APT policy: (650, 'testing'), (600, 'unstable') Architecture: i386 (i686) Kernel: Linux 2.6.10-reiser4-fbsplash-swsuspend Locale: LANG=en_GB, LC_CTYPE=en_GB (charmap=ISO-8859-1) -- To UNSUBSCRIBE, email to [EMAIL PROTECTED] with a subject of "unsubscribe".
